Exodus 27:8
Construct the altar with boards so that it is hollow. It is to be made just as you were shown on the mountain.
King James Version
Hollow with boards shalt thou make it: as it was shewed thee in the mount, so shall they make it.
World English Bible
You shall make it hollow with planks. They shall make it as it has been shown you on the mountain.
American Standard Version
Hollow with planks shalt thou make it: as it hath been showed thee in the mount, so shall they make it.
Geneva Bible 1599
Thou shalt make the altar holowe betweene the boardes: as God shewed thee in the mount, so shall they make it.
Darby Translation
Hollow with boards shalt thou make it: as it hath been shewn thee on the mountain, so shall they make [it].
Young's Literal Translation
Hollow with boards thou dost make it, as it hath been shewed thee in the mount, so do they make [it].
Bible in Basic English
The altar is to be hollow, boarded in with wood; make it from the design which you saw on the mountain.
